13:22 30 July, 2026Kanye West has reached a settlement with his former personal assistant, Lauren Pisciotta, who accused the rapper of sexual harassment and sexual assault.
According to court documents obtained by the Daily Mail, Pisciotta’s legal team has officially notified the court that the lawsuit has been resolved.
The agreement is classified as "unconditional," and attorneys will ask the judge to dismiss the case entirely within 45 days. The financial payout and specific terms of the settlement remain undisclosed.
Lauren Pisciotta worked with West from 2021 to 2023, serving as his personal assistant and chief of staff across his music and fashion empires.
She initially filed her lawsuit in 2024 before dramatically expanding her claims in the summer of 2025. According to Pisciotta's filing, the rapper:
Inappropriate Messages: Regularly sent her sexually explicit text messages and pressured her into sex.
Private Jet Incident: Masturbated in front of her on board a private flight.
Hotel Encounter During Donda: Forced her into bed with him at a hotel while working on the Donda album before attempting to grope her.
Allegations of Assault: Stormed into her hotel room under the pretext of taking a shower, dropped his towel, pinned her to the bed, and sexually assaulted her.
Pisciotta asserted that she repeatedly tried to reject the musician's advances, emphasizing their unprofessional nature. However, West allegedly continued the harassment despite occasional apologies.
Kanye West and his legal team vehemently denied all allegations from the outset of the proceedings.
